Directions
1
Season two chuck roasts with Montreal steak seasoning and sear them.
2
Thinly slice four onions.
3
Pour 32 oz of beef stock into the crock pot.
4
Drizzle balsamic vinegar on top of the onions.
5
Add some Worcestershire sauce.
6
Sprinkle about two teaspoons of thyme on top.
7
Sprinkle about two teaspoons of rosemary on top, ensuring it's spread evenly.
8
Drizzle soy sauce on top.
9
Add four chopped large cloves of garlic.
10
Tuck a couple of bay leaves into the crock pot.
11
Stir the ingredients halfway through the cooking time.
12
Place the lid on the crock pot.
13
Cook on high for 3 to 4 hours or on low for 7 to 8 hours.
14
Shred the cooked meat.
15
Spread hoagie buns with homemade herbed butter or regular butter.
16
Place some provolone cheese on the hoagie bun.
17
Put shredded meat on the toasted hoagie bun.
18
Serve with the flavorful broth for dipping.
Ingredients
2 chuck roast
Montreal steak seasoning
4 onions, thinly sliced
32 oz beef stock
balsamic vinegar
Worcestershire
2 teaspoons thyme
2 teaspoons rosemary
soy sauce
4 large cloves of garlic, chopped
2 bay leaves
hoagie bun
homemade herbed butter
provolone cheese
